Find the solution of this system of equations.
Separate the x- and y-values with a comma.
X + 10y = 29
x - y = 7

Answer:

x = 9, y = 2

Step-by-step explanation:

Given the 2 equations

x + 10y = 29 → (1)

x - y = 7 → (2)

Subtracting (2) from (1) term by term will eliminate the term in x

(x - x) + (10y - (- y)) = (29 - 7), that is

11y = 22 ( divide both sides by 11 )

y = 2

Substitute y = 2 in either of the 2 equations

Substituting in (2)

x - 2 = 7 ( add 2 to both sides )

x = 9
